DESCRIPTION:Chaidh Sgoil Eòlais na h-Alba air a stèidheachadh o chionn 75 bliadhnaichean gus fiosrachadh mu bheatha sa choimhearsnachd\, beul-aithris agus na h-ealan traidiseanta a chruinneachadh. Bheir an taisbeanadh seo sùil air clàraidhean-fuaime\, dealbhan agus làmh-sgrìobhainnean a tha a’ sealltainn beatha nan Gàidheal agus cànan is cultar na Gàidhlig san linn a dh’fhalbh. \nCelebrating its 75th anniversary this year\, the School of Scottish Studies was set up to gather material on community life\, folklore and the traditional arts. This presentation will explore sound recordings\, photographs and manuscripts to give an insight into the lives of Gaels\, Gaelic language and culture during the past century. \nGàidhlig is Beurla | Gaelic and English \nSaor an-asgaidh ach feumaidh sibh clàradh. | Free but registration required. \nDealbh / Image: SS Hebrides in Village Bay\, St Kilda\, 1938. DESCRIPTION:Seinnidh is mìnichidh sinn mu Òrain Luaidh. Bhiodh ‘luadhadh’ air a dhèanamh mar bu thrice le boireannaich gus clò a thiughachadh le bhith ga thoirt a-steach\, agus rinneadh iad an obair fhada seo na b’ aotroime le òrain. Am measg luchd-imrich Albannach ann an Canada\, bhiodh fireannaich a’ seinn cuideachd. Cothrom gus pàirt a ghabhail ann. \nWe will perform and explain about waulking songs\, Òrain Luaidh. ‘Waulking’ was done usually by women to thicken tweed by shrinking it\, and the lengthy task lightened by singing. Amongst Scots migrants to Canada\, men would sing too. Opportunity to participate. \nGàidhlig is Beurla | Gaelic and English \nSaor an-asgaidh | Free
